rx2600 vga display

Hi,

I need to access the single user mode to increase the size of /opt, the problem is that I don't have a serial console. When I boot with vga display I can not access the o/s, I received console is on serial device, No futher output will appear on this output device. I have made the modification in the EFI to allow active console to display to the VGA output.

Re: rx2600 vga display

A couple of possible options:

Those boxes ship with a GSP card(i think). That can let you connect the box to a network and actually ssh/telnet into the GSP card. This can give you console access.

The box may have a secure webconsole, which once again lets you connect the device to the network and the console connector on the Core I/O card and gain console access like that.

Please if possible, go look at the box and see if it has a configured web console or GSP card.

I can provide instructions on how to gain console access for either method.

The Web console is a little easier because if you power it on with the button on top held down, it resets the unit to factory defaults. Then you can connect to it with a browser and configure it.

Re: rx2600 vga display

Hi,

for HP-UX you can't use build-in VGA port.
The only way is to connect serial cable to MP
console.

You don't need specialized serial console,
just use some PC or laptop.
